About the Event
Can you use a lathe and wood-turning tools? If you are an adult and you would like to learn, this might be the course for you. Once you have learnt the basics you will then experience the pleasure and satisfaction of creating objects such as tool handles, bowls, vases and other items to make and perhaps give as gifts.
The course will include:
characteristics of wood
Lathe and components
Safety procedures for all tools and lathe
Tool use incl. skew chisel, bowl/spindle gouges, parting tool- all using the ABC practice of wood turning
Chuck mounting techniques
Face plate and spindle turning
Sanding and polishing
Tool sharpening
Projects to make (dibber, bowl, saucer, bud vase, candle stick etc)
All consumables are provided, including wood blanks, sand paper, polish, glue and all tools for use during lessons. Lathes are electronically speed controlled.

Who will be teaching?
Brian Falkenberg, will be your experienced teacher. Brian undertook a two-year apprenticeship with a professional turner and has been producing wood turned articles for 15 years. He also runs classes at his home in Woodend and has an extensive stock of native wood species. He loves sharing his skills and encouraging others to enjoy learning this craft and creating fine objects. Brian’s work has been exhibited at the Stoneycreek Gallery in Daylesford; the Treehouse Gallery in Birregurra and at “Art on Piper” in Kyneton.
